		<description>I have been receiving letters from them as well, I have already asked them to remove me from the list and to never contact me again. Guess what? A couple months later, I get another one for another domain name I own. I warned them last time that if they do contact me again, I would contact ICANN as well as the BBB. After searching on Google a bit, I decided to also file a complaint with the FTC, which I did a few minutes ago. So they now have a complaint from me with ICANN (which they are accredited under Namejuice.com/BRANDON GRAY INTERNET SERVICES), BBB, and FTC.

I see that in 2003 the FTC took action against them while DRoA was reselling for eNom. I came across your blog while searching Google for more information about these scammers. I love the recording. It is amusing how when backed in to a corner they behave like the rats they are. They hide. Count me as one !@#$!@#% off consumer!</description>
